Unboxing and Initial Setup
Start by unboxing your Coros Pace 3 and charging it fully using the included charger. Once charged, turn on the device by pressing and holding the side button. Follow the on-screen prompts to select your language and agree to the terms and conditions.
Connecting to the Coros App
Download the Coros app from the App Store or Google Play. Open the app and create an account or log in. Enable Bluetooth on your smartphone. In the app, select “Add Device” and follow the prompts to pair your Pace 3 with your phone.
Setting Up Personal Profiles
In the app, navigate to the profile section. Enter your personal details such as age, weight, height, and gender. This information helps the device provide accurate metrics during your runs. Save your profile once completed.
Configuring Run Settings
Access the device settings via the app or directly on the watch. Set your preferred units (miles or kilometers), enable GPS, and choose your activity types. Customize auto-lap and auto-pause features based on your running style.
Personalizing Data Screens
Customize the data screens to display metrics important to you, such as pace, distance, heart rate, and calories. Use the app to arrange the order of data fields for quick glances during your run.
Setting Up Heart Rate Monitoring
Ensure your heart rate monitor is properly paired. The Pace 3 supports wrist-based heart rate tracking. Confirm that the sensor is snug but comfortable on your wrist. Enable continuous heart rate monitoring in settings for real-time feedback.
Creating Running Goals
Use the app to set goals for distance, time, or calories. These goals motivate you and help track progress over time. You can adjust or reset these goals before each run.
Syncing and Testing Your Setup
Sync your device with the app to ensure all settings are correctly transferred. Take a short test run to verify GPS accuracy, heart rate monitoring, and data display. Make adjustments as needed for optimal performance.
